Architecture for Healthcare and the Community: The New Community Hospital in Maranello Officially Opens

A 1,200 sqm healthcare facility serving the Ceramic District, created through the synergy of PNRR funding, local institutions, and forward-thinking design.

On Friday, 17 July 2026, the official inauguration ceremony of the new Community Hospital (OSCO) for the Ceramic District took place. The facility is located on Via Cappella in the hamlet of Gorzano, Maranello. The event was attended by leading institutional and healthcare representatives from the Emilia-Romagna Region and the Province of Modena, including Regional President Michele de Pascale, Regional Councillor for Health Policies Massimo Fabi, AUSL Modena Director General Mattia Altini, Director of the Sassuolo Health District Federica Ronchetti, the Mayor of Maranello Luigi Zironi, and the Mayor of Sassuolo Matteo Mesini.

An architectural bridge between hospital and home

Designed by Archilinea, the new OSCO responds to the growing demand for intermediate and community-based healthcare services. Covering a gross floor area of approximately 1,200 square metres, the facility accommodates 15 inpatient beds for patients who no longer require high-intensity hospital care but still need continuous medical assistance, rehabilitation treatments, or support in managing healthcare devices before returning home. The design of both the indoor and outdoor spaces was guided by the principle of humanising healthcare. Rational, flexible, and light-filled environments maximise operational efficiency for healthcare professionals while providing patients with a comfortable, safe, and reassuring setting throughout their stay.

Financial synergy and a shared territorial vision

The project represents a total investment of more than €4.2 million, made possible largely through Italy's National Recovery and Resilience Plan (PNRR – Mission 6: Health), supplemented by AUSL corporate funding. The project also highlights the value of territorial collaboration. The Municipality of Maranello granted the land surface rights free of charge and carried out the urbanisation works, with the essential support of Fondazione di Modena and Ferrari S.p.A.
